> -----Original Message----- > From: dev [mailto:dev-bounces at dpdk.org] On Behalf Of Bernard Iremonger > Sent: Wednesday, December 23, 2015 9:45 AM > To: dev at dpdk.org > Subject: [dpdk-dev] [PATCH] virtio: fix crashes in virtio stats functions > > This initialisation of nb_rx_queues and nb_tx_queues has been removed > from eth_virtio_dev_init. > > The nb_rx_queues and nb_tx_queues were being initialised in > eth_virtio_dev_init > before the tx_queues and rx_queues arrays were allocated. > > The arrays are allocated when the ethdev port is configured and the > nb_tx_queues and nb_rx_queues are initialised. > > If any of the following functions were called before the ethdev > port was configured there was a segmentation fault because > rx_queues and tx_queues were NULL: > > rte_eth_stats_get > rte_eth_stats_reset > rte_eth_xstats_get > rte_eth_xstats_reset > > Fixes: 823ad647950a ("virtio: support multiple queues") > Signed-off-by: Bernard Iremonger <bernard.iremonger at intel.com> > --- > drivers/net/virtio/virtio_ethdev.c | 3 --- > 1 file changed, 3 deletions(-) > > diff --git a/drivers/net/virtio/virtio_ethdev.c > b/drivers/net/virtio/virtio_ethdev.c > index d928339..5ef0752 100644 > --- a/drivers/net/virtio/virtio_ethdev.c > +++ b/drivers/net/virtio/virtio_ethdev.c > @@ -1378,9 +1378,6 @@ eth_virtio_dev_init(struct rte_eth_dev *eth_dev) > hw->max_tx_queues = 1; > } > > - eth_dev->data->nb_rx_queues = hw->max_rx_queues; > - eth_dev->data->nb_tx_queues = hw->max_tx_queues; > - > PMD_INIT_LOG(DEBUG, "hw->max_rx_queues=%d hw->max_tx_queues=%d", > hw->max_rx_queues, hw->max_tx_queues); > PMD_INIT_LOG(DEBUG, "port %d vendorID=0x%x deviceID=0x%x", > --
